Build Provenance: Sorting Stability in Gridforge Report Builder. For reviewers: report outputs must be byte-identical across rebuilds to support provenance attestation. The column sorter previously used an unstable sort, so rows with equal keys could reorder between builds, breaking hash comparisons. As of the current release, Gridforge uses a stable merge sort with a documented tiebreaker on row ingestion order. Any diff in output hashes now indicates a genuine data or code change. Verify attestations against the build token recorded below.

session token of tajef-bageg = htk21_5d90d574934f3ccae6437

Welcome to the Tickwise plugin program! Quick heads-up before you dig in: we're mid-investigation on cron drift in the Pendle scheduler, so if your plugin's hooks fire a few seconds late, that's us, not you. Jot anything weird in the drift channel and the core team will triage. To access the shared investigation vault where we keep timing dumps, you'll need the recovery passphrase below.

vault phrase of bafop-kahop = sormir-frador

// REINDEX_BATCH_CAP limits docs per shard pass in the Tallowfield
// nightly search reindex. Raising it starves the ingest queue;
// lowering it overruns the maintenance window. 5000 is the tested
// sweet spot. Change only with a soak run. Verified against the
// build noted below.

session token of bawif-hahog = htk6_ac5981